Adebayo Adelabu Resigns as Minister to Pursue Governorship

Adebayo Adelabu Resigns as Minister to Pursue Governorship

Adebayo Adelabu, the former Minister of Power, formally submitted his resignation letter on April 22, 2023, to exit President Bola Ahmed Tinubu's cabinet, effective April 30, 2023. Adelabu's resignation follows his appointment as Minister of Power in August 2023, which was confirmed by the Senate.

He has decided to pursue a governorship ambition in Oyo State. During a meeting with President Tinubu, Adelabu informed him of his decision, which received the President's approval.

In a press conference on March 24, 2023, Adelabu emphasized the need for stronger policies to address Nigeria's electricity challenges and proposed the creation of a coordinating ministry for energy reform across the electricity generation sector. Photographs surfaced showing Adelabu alongside Secretary to the Government of the Federation, George Akume, as he submitted his resignation letter.
